Assassin Snails, also known as Clea Helena, are a species of freshwater snail native to Southeast Asia. They are popular in the aquarium hobby for their ability to control populations of pest snails. These snails are slow-moving and have a unique, cone-shaped shell that can grow up to 2 inches in length. They feed on other snails, and this makes them very effective at controlling pest snail populations in aquariums. In order to care for assassin snails, it is important to provide them with a well-established aquarium with plenty of hiding spots, live plants, and a balanced diet that includes both protein and vegetables. They are also sensitive to poor water quality, so it is important to maintain a stable environment for them to thrive in. Assassin snails are peaceful and do not pose a threat to other aquarium inhabitants. They are also non-toxic and safe to keep with fish and other invertebrates.
